Flaming Arrow Rock
Flaming Arrow Rock is a peak in Gallatin, Montana and has an elevation of 4,980 feet. Flaming Arrow Rock is situated nearby to the neighborhood Bridger Canyon, as well as near Creekwood.Places in the Area

Bozeman is a city in Montana's Yellowstone Country. Set in the middle of the Rocky Mountains, this college town is a place for experiencing the great outdoors around the year, and for those days the weather makes you want to stay indoors there are a number of museums and galleries to explore.
